Output 4358963c35e376091e5f828f7c8228bdc5ac88061ba05ee2b91e86933338d2d4:0

value
5660000
script pubkey
OP_0 OP_PUSHBYTES_20 5c8a44600e7b44cf8da106c2e776fc713fcdc77e
address
bc1qtj9ygcqw0dzvlrdpqmpwwahuwylum3m7c60h3d
transaction
4358963c35e376091e5f828f7c8228bdc5ac88061ba05ee2b91e86933338d2d4
spent
true